一、准备知识 链路状态路路由选择算法是一种全局式路由选择算法。在此算法中,我们是假设所有网络拓扑和链路费用都是已知的(实践中通常是通过让每个结点向网络中所有其他节点广播链路状态分组来完成的)【OSPF协议】,通过节点广播使所有结点具备了该网络等同的完整视图。获得视图之后,通过LS算法可以计算出从源节点到网络任...
Dijkstra算法是典型的LS路由算法,可计算在网络中从一个节点到所有其他节点的最短路径。 之前在数据结构课上已经初步学习过这个算法,代码直接给出。 #include"stdio.h"#include"stdlib.h"#defineMAX 30000intn;intArraya[100][100];intBeginningPath()//说明初始化的路由连接信息{inti,j,t;printf("请输入节点的...
LS路由算法 采⽤LS算法时,每个路由器必须遵循以下步骤: ls算法的步骤流程 1、确认在物理上与之相连的路由器并获得它们的IP地址。当⼀个路由器开始⼯作后,它⾸先向整个⽹络发送⼀ 个“HELLO”分组数据包。每个接收到数据包的路由器都将返回⼀条消息,其中包含它⾃⾝的IP地址。 2、测量...
129.LS与DV路由选择算法的比较是【计算机网络】计算机网络-自顶向下方法(大神之路-起始篇)的第91集视频,该合集共计163集,视频收藏或关注UP主,及时了解更多相关视频内容。
使用最短路径优先算法,算法复杂度为O(n^2) n个结点(不包括源结点),需要n*(n+1)/2 次比较 使用更有效的实现方法,算法复杂度可以达到O(nlogn) 可能存在路由振荡(oscillations) 结点会广播错误的链路开销 每个结点只计算自己的路由表 LS(链路状态)
1、LS路由算法与DV路由算法的比较徐雄博 信息安全 2 班摘要:当一个分组要从源主机带目的主机时,网络层必须确定从发送方到接受方的分组所采用的路径。选路算法的目的就是给定一组路由器以及连接路由器的链路,选路算法要找到一条从源路由器到目的路由器的“好”的路径,即具有最低费用的路径。根据算法是全局性的...
用java实现ls路由算法 使用Java实现LS路由算法 简介 路由算法是计算机网络中的重要组成部分,用于确定数据包在网络中的传输路径。最短路径优先(Link State,简称LS)路由算法是一种常用的路由算法之一,它基于图论中的最短路径算法,通过计算网络中各节点之间的最短路径来确定数据包的传输路径。本文将介绍如何使用Java语言...
2.LS算法 #include "stdio.h" #include"stdlib.h" #define MAX 30000 int n; int Arraya[100][100]; int BeginningPath()//说明初始化的路由连接信息 { int i,j,t; printf("请输入节点的个数:"); scanf("%d",&n);//一共有n个节点
路由算法之LS算法和DV算法全面分析 转载文章:https://blog.csdn.net/qq_22238021/article/details/80496138 很透彻!!!